package com.twelvemonkeys.util;

import java.util.HashMap;
import java.util.Map;

import org.junit.jupiter.api.*;
import static org.junit.jupiter.api.Assertions.*;

/**
 * NOTE: This TestCase is written especially for NullMap, and is full of dirty
 * tricks. A good indication that NullMap is not a good, general-purpose Map
 * implementation...
 *
 * @author <a href="mailto:harald.kuhr@gmail.com">Harald Kuhr</a>
 * @version $Id: //depot/branches/personal/haraldk/twelvemonkeys/release-2/twelvemonkeys-core/src/test/java/com/twelvemonkeys/util/NullMapTestCase.java#2 $
 */
public class NullMapTest extends MapAbstractTest {
    private boolean empty = true;

    public Map makeEmptyMap() {
        return new NullMap();
    }

    public Map makeFullMap() {
        return new NullMap();
    }

    public Map makeConfirmedMap() {
        // Always empty
        return new HashMap();
    }

    public void resetEmpty() {
        empty = true;
        super.resetEmpty();
    }

    public void resetFull() {
        empty = false;
        super.resetFull();
    }

    public void verifyAll() {
        if (empty) {
            super.verifyAll();
        }
    }

    // Overriden, as this map is always empty
    @Test
    @Override
    public void testMapIsEmpty() {
        resetEmpty();
        assertEquals(true, map.isEmpty(),
                "Map.isEmpty() should return true with an empty map");
        verifyAll();
        resetFull();
        assertEquals(true, map.isEmpty(),
                "Map.isEmpty() should return true with a full map");
    }

    // Overriden, as this map is always empty
    @Test
    @Override
    public void testMapSize() {
        resetEmpty();
        assertEquals(0, map.size(),
                "Map.size() should be 0 with an empty map");
        verifyAll();

        resetFull();
        assertEquals(0, map.size(),
                "Map.size() should equal the number of entries in the map");
    }

    @Test
    @Override
    public void testMapContainsKey() {
        Object[] keys = getSampleKeys();

        resetEmpty();
        for (Object key : keys) {
            assertTrue(!map.containsKey(key),"Map must not contain key when map is empty");
        }
        verifyAll();
    }

    @Test
    @Override
    public void testMapContainsValue() {
        Object[] values = getSampleValues();

        resetEmpty();
        for (Object value : values) {
            assertTrue(!map.containsValue(value), "Empty map must not contain value");
        }
        verifyAll();
    }

    @Test
    @Override
    public void testMapEquals() {
        resetEmpty();
        assertTrue(map.equals(confirmed), "Empty maps unequal.");
        verifyAll();
    }

    @Test
    @Override
    public void testMapHashCode() {
        resetEmpty();
        assertTrue(map.hashCode() == confirmed.hashCode(), "Empty maps have different hashCodes.");
    }

    @Test
    @Override
    public void testMapGet() {
        resetEmpty();

        Object[] keys = getSampleKeys();

        for (Object key : keys) {
            assertTrue(map.get(key) == null, "Empty map.get() should return null.");
        }
        verifyAll();
    }

    @Test
    @Override
    public void testMapPut() {
        resetEmpty();
        Object[] keys = getSampleKeys();
        Object[] values = getSampleValues();
        Object[] newValues = getNewSampleValues();

        for (int i = 0; i < keys.length; i++) {
            Object o = map.put(keys[i], values[i]);
            //confirmed.put(keys[i], values[i]);
            verifyAll();
            assertTrue(o == null, "First map.put should return null");
        }
        for (int i = 0; i < keys.length; i++) {
            map.put(keys[i], newValues[i]);
            //confirmed.put(keys[i], newValues[i]);
            verifyAll();
        }
    }

    @Test
    @Override
    public void testMapToString() {
        resetEmpty();
        assertTrue(map.toString() != null,
                "Empty map toString() should not return null");
        verifyAll();
    }

    @Test
    @Override
    public void testMapPutAll() {
        // TODO: Find a menaingful way to test this
    }

    @Test
    @Override
    public void testMapRemove() {
        resetEmpty();

        Object[] keys = getSampleKeys();
        for(int i = 0; i < keys.length; i++) {
            Object o = map.remove(keys[i]);
            assertTrue(o == null, "First map.remove should return null");
        }
        verifyAll();
    }
